Overall Review
Pros
The administrator was very personable and caring, dedicating three hours to address concerns and making life easier for the reviewer.
Nurse Kethrine received high praise for her impressive work during late nights with the reviewer’s family.
The rehabilitation process is going well, indicating the facility is well-staffed and attentive to the needs of patients.
The reviewer expressed overall happiness with their experience at the facility so far.
Cons
The day staff is very nasty and unprofessional.
The reviewer feels uneasy about leaving their loved one in the care of the staff.
There is a suggestion that if employees do not like their job, they should find another one, indicating dissatisfaction with staff attitude.
The reviewer strongly advises against leaving loved ones at this facility, expressing extreme discontent.
There is a call for the place to be closed down due to poor experiences with the staff.

Description
Mayfair Care Center in Hempstead, NY offers comprehensive care and support for seniors in a skilled nursing facility setting. Our community is equipped with various amenities to enhance the quality of life for our residents. Our on-site beautician and beauty salon allow residents to maintain their grooming and personal care needs conveniently. Residents can enjoy their favorite shows or movies with cable or satellite TV access in their rooms. We provide community-operated transportation for outings and appointments and have a computer center for residents to stay connected with loved ones.
Meals are served in our dining room, offering restaurant-style dining experiences with specialized dietary options available. Residents can also choose to have meals served in their rooms through our room service option. Our fitness room promotes physical well-being, while the gaming room provides opportunities for leisure activities and socialization. A serene garden allows residents to enjoy outdoor spaces at their leisure.
At Mayfair Care Center, we prioritize the comfort and privacy of our residents by providing fully furnished rooms with private bathrooms and housekeeping services. Laundry facilities are available onsite for added convenience.
Our dedicated staff is available 24/7 and assists residents with activities of daily living, including bathing, dressing, and transfers. We also offer medication management services to ensure proper administration of medications. Mental wellness programs are implemented to support the emotional well-being of our residents.
Mayfair Care Center is conveniently located near various amenities such as cafes, parks, pharmacies, physicians' offices, restaurants, transportation options, places of worship, theaters, and hospitals. We offer scheduled daily activities and resident-run initiatives to promote engagement within our community.
